Uplink Corporation needs you, the Hacker Elite!
Be an independent operator who leases a gateway from us. Access it from anywhere and perform your jobs, anything from sabotage of enemy computers to backtrack another hacker, to modifying public databases, you may be called upon to do it all. Start with the small jobs, and gain money and reputation. Then you can take on the bigger jobs with the right tools and upgrades to your gateway. Consider adding motion sensor and/or self-destruct to your gateway... as Uplink will allow law enforcement personnel access to your gateway should they trace illegal activities to your gateway. Can you become the elite among the Hacker Elite?
Uplink is a pseudo-hacking game where you simulate hacking into various systems and using various fictional (but good sounding) tools to help you break through, including password guessers, cryptographic attack tools, voiceprint fakers, proxy bypassers, and more. Bounce your connection through many hosts to slow down the backtrace. Perform your job before the backtrace is completed, and destroy any records of you ever been there! The law can and will come after you if you are not careful. However, opportunities are plentiful. Various corporations are always at war with each other, and there are plenty of jobs for hackers of various calibers. As you complete missions and get money and reputation, use the money to upgrade your gateway (to process faster on tasks that require a lot of computing, such as password guessing and cryptographic key attacks) and/or to purchase more powerful hacking tools. Continue to participate in the game and make your decisions. Soon, the game will draw you in, and you'll soon be required to make a choice... and pick a side.

Trivia
When entering negotiations for a hacking job on the Uplink Internal Services system, if you look at the negotiations text box near the top of the screen when it is starting up, it will say that the interface you are using has been developed by 'Frontier Communications'.
This is a joke referencing
Frontier: Elite 2 and
Frontier: First Encounters. The design and text for this particular interface in Uplink mirrors/copies the content found in the BBS-accessible missions from the two Frontier games.
It additionally references the name of the company that developed these entries into the
Elite series;
Frontier Developments.
